Correlation analysis revealed that anthocyanin had a highly significant negative correlation with chlorophyll content, and that chlorophyll a and b content had a significant negative correlation with a* , while anthocyanin content had a highly significant positive correlation with a* , C* and color light value, indicating that over time, anthocyanin content decreased, while chlorophyll content gradually increased, and that the two changes were in opposite directions.
